Transaction 3e5b9337cd39d8b089a25615fb0a48255bb076c81bcc7e7cd4e90d258f2f4a0d
1 Input
1 Outputs
- 3e5b9337cd39d8b089a25615fb0a48255bb076c81bcc7e7cd4e90d258f2f4a0d:0
value 654848
address 17xGiEBbegEiJWwjALXTHoLsjyCURiD19G